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
4 changes: 3 additions & 1 deletion tableauserverclient/server/endpoint/server_info_endpoint.py
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
from .endpoint import Endpoint, api
from .exceptions import ServerResponseError, ServerInfoEndpointNotFoundError
from .exceptions import ServerResponseError, ServerInfoEndpointNotFoundError, EndpointUnavailableError
from ...models import ServerInfoItem
import logging

Expand All @@ -19,6 +19,8 @@ def get(self):
except ServerResponseError as e:
if e.code == "404003":
raise ServerInfoEndpointNotFoundError
if e.code == "404001":
raise EndpointUnavailableError

server_info = ServerInfoItem.from_response(server_response.content, self.parent_srv.namespace)
return server_info
2 changes: 1 addition & 1 deletion test/test_sort.py
Original file line number Diff line number Diff line change
Expand Up @@ -58,7 +58,7 @@ def test_filter_in(self):
auth_token='j80k54ll2lfMZ0tv97mlPvvSCRyD0DOM',
content_type='text/xml')

self.assertEqual(resp.request.query, 'pagenumber=13&pagesize=13&filter=tags:in:[stocks,market]')
self.assertEqual(resp.request.query, 'pagenumber=13&pagesize=13&filter=tags:in:%5bstocks,market%5d')

def test_sort_asc(self):
with requests_mock.mock() as m:
Expand Down